Frequently Asked Questions

How many students attend Aia Lancaster Elementary School?
8 students attend Aia Lancaster Elementary School.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
50% of Aia Lancaster Elementary School students are Hispanic, and 50% of students are Black.
What grades does Aia Lancaster Elementary School offer ?
Aia Lancaster Elementary School offers enrollment in grades Prekindergarten-6
What school district is Aia Lancaster Elementary School part of?
Aia Lancaster Elementary School is part of Accelerated Intermediate Academy School District.
In what neighborhood is Aia Lancaster Elementary School located?
Aia Lancaster Elementary School is located in the Northside neighborhood of Houston, TX. There are 58 other public schools located in Northside.
